So, you're drawn to the world of Gunpla? Fantastic ! These impressive Gundam model kits can seem complex at first, but don't fret ! This quick guide will get you started with the basics . Gunpla, short for "Gundam Plastic Model," involves assembling plastic parts into incredibly accurate representations of the iconic mobile suits from the Gundam series . You'll find a range of grades, from easy-to-build entry-level kits to complex Master Grades and Perfect Grades, each offering a progressively difficult endeavor. Let's go explore!

Sophisticated Model Kit Techniques : Detailing and Personalization
Beyond standard assembly, skilled builders often delve into complex Gunpla techniques . Weathering – the method of simulating wear and tear – adds a level of realism to your figure. This can involve incorporating washes, pigments, dry brushing, and even creating panels. personalization takes this a step further, involving modifying the frame's appearance through finishing, incorporating extra parts, and even sculpting plastic pieces to create a truly personalized masterpiece .
Some Top Gunpla Builds for Intermediate Hobbyists
So, you've tackled a few beginner Gunpla projects and are move up to something a tad more involved? Excellent ! This group features Gunpla suited for the developing builder. Consider the HGUC Zeta Gundam – its detailed folding system offers a glimpse to more advanced techniques. The HG Wing Gundam Zero is similarly a worthwhile choice, with its various wings and moving parts. Finally, the HG Barbatos offers a great blend of complexity and accessibility, allowing it a perfect next step. Keep in mind to look at the component count and skill rating before commencing!
